Section 503 of the Supplemental Appropriations Act of 1987, Public Law 100-71, 101 Stat. 391, 468-471, codified at Title 5 … Orthotropic materials have three planes/axes of symmetry. An isotropicmaterial, in contrast, has the same properties in every direction. It can be proved that a material having two planes of symmetry must have a third one. Isotropic materials have an infinite number of planes of symmetry. See more In material science and solid mechanics, orthotropic materials have material properties at a particular point which differ along three orthogonal axes, where each axis has twofold rotational symmetry. Coupled fluid-structure Lagrange equations for open systems with wave propagation subject to pulsatile flow are … im always with uWebJan 1, 1995 · Based on Flugge's linear theory for isotropic cylindrical shells, a general buckling solution under combined axial compression and external pressure was derived. … im always with you split theatreWebJul 1, 2024 · The cylindrical orthotropy is a lower level of the cylindrical anisotropy it has a weaker coupling between the radial and circumferential directions as in case of the cylindrical anisotropy. An example of body having cylindrical orthotropy is a wooden bar with regular circular cylindrical rings, when the curvature of annual rings is not negligible. list of gothic clothing makers
